Emphasizing how modes of book production, promotion, and
consumption shape ideas of literary value, Edward Mack examines the
role of Japan's publishing industry in defining modern Japanese
literature. In the late nineteenth century and early twentieth, as
cultural and economic power consolidated in Tokyo, the city's
literary and publishing elites came to dominate the dissemination
and preservation of Japanese literature. As Mack explains, they
conferred cultural value on particular works by creating prizes and
multivolume anthologies that signaled literary merit. One such
anthology, the "Complete Works of Contemporary Japanese Literature"
(published between 1926 and 1931), provided many readers with their
first experience of selected texts designated as modern Japanese
literature. The low price of one yen per volume allowed the series
to reach hundreds of thousands of readers. An early prize for
modern Japanese literature, the annual Akutagawa Prize, first
awarded in 1935, became the country's highest-profile literary
award. Mack chronicles the history of book production and
consumption in Japan, showing how advances in technology, the
expansion of a market for literary commodities, and the development
of an extensive reading community enabled phenomena such as the
"Complete Works of Contemporary Japanese Literature" and the
Akutagawa Prize to manufacture the very concept of modern Japanese
literature.
